Judge Orders Recount In Northern Riding
Monday, February 06, 2006 at 15:33
A judicial recount has been ordered in the federal riding of Desnethe-Missinippi-Churchill River.
The northern Saskatchewan constituency has been in turmoil since allegations of irregularities surfaced shortly after the Liberals’ Gary Merasty defeated incumbent Conservative MP Jeremy Harrison by 73 votes.
Court of Queen’s Bench Madame Justice Allisen Rothery heard arguments for and against a recount on Friday, and today, agreed with Harrison’s legal team that a recount is necessary.
Rothery noted in her judgment that there were counting mistakes in six polls in the riding.
The recount will take place Wednesday morning at Prince Albert Court of Queen’s Bench.
The process will start at 11:00 am and will be supervised by a judge and three representatives from both the Merasty and Harrison camps.
